Olomouc is a city in the Czech Republic. It has about 103,000 inhabitants, making it the sixth largest city in the country. It is the administrative centre of the Olomouc Region. Read more on Wikipedia

Between 1031 and 2000, Olomouc was the birth place of 20 globally memorable people, including Frederick, Duke of Bohemia, Spytihněv II, Duke of Bohemia, and Karel Brückner. Additionaly, 3 globally memorable people have passed away in Olomouc including Petr Bezruč, Jan Sarkander, and Wenceslaus III of Bohemia.

Most individuals born in present day Olomouc were politicians (5), soccer players (4), tennis players (3), athletes (2), and coaches (1),  while most who died were writers (1), religious figures (1), and politicians (1).

Over the past 100 years, soccer players have been the top profession of globally memorable people born in Olomouc, including Marek Heinz, Tomáš Kalas, and David Zima. Whereas, throughout history, politicians have been the profession with the most memorable people born in present day Olomouc, including Frederick, Duke of Bohemia, Spytihněv II, Duke of Bohemia, and Svatopluk, Duke of Bohemia.
